共查询到20条相似文献,搜索用时 156 毫秒
1.
通过对步进电机的驱动控制原理的分析,利用Verilog语言进行层次化设计,最后实现了基于FPGA步进电机的驱动控制系统.该系统可以实现步进电机按既定角度和方向转动及定位控制等功能.仿真和综合的结果表明,该系统不但可以达到对步进电机的驱动控制,同时也优化了传统的系统结构,提高了系统的抗干扰能力和稳定性,可用于工业自动化、... 相似文献
2.
本文提出一种采用FPGA对步进电机速度与位置控制的方法,建立一种步进电机驱动控制系统,该系统采用脉冲频率实现步进电机速度控制,可防止失步和过冲,提高工作效率,并结合实际工作控制,结果表明该方法的可行性。 相似文献
3.
步进电机加减速控制器的设计 总被引:6,自引:0,他引:6
步进电机易于控制、快速响应性好、并可在很宽的范围内进行平滑调速,是数控机床、打印机、绘图仪、机器人控制等自动控制系统中广泛应用的执行元件。步进电机的起动频率特性使步进电机启动时不能直接达到运行频率,而要有一个启动过程,即从一个低的转速逐渐升速到运行转速。停止时运行频率不能立即降为零,而要有一个高速逐渐降速到零的过程。 相似文献
4.
步进电机作为执行机构在电子对抗装备伺服系统中得到了广泛的应用,但其控制器都较为复杂,给出了一种在多用途步进电机运动控制系统中应用现场可编程门阵列(FPGA)实现步进电机控制的方法.实验结果表明系统扩展方便,可移植性高,同时具有广泛的适应性. 相似文献
5.
介绍了一种利用EDA技术,实现步进电机控制系统数字输入的方法,从而实现了对步进电机的精确控制。并对该系统的结构、各模块功能以及程序设计优化、综合、仿真、下载做了详细论述。 相似文献
6.
基于FPGA的步进电机定位控制系统的设计 总被引:1,自引:1,他引:1
主要介绍了利用Altera公司的10K10型号的FPGA芯片来实现步进电机的定位控制系统设计的全过程,本系统是基于51单片机控制,以FPGA芯片来实现驱动步进电机的脉冲分配,并作为核心电路加以必要的数字模拟辅助电路,形成一个4相8拍步进电机定位控制系统。实验证明,此方法是基于目前较流行的FPGA芯片,控制精确且稳定度极高,切实可行有效的设计思想和方法。 相似文献
7.
采用AT89C51单片机为核心,通过系统硬件和软件的设计来实现对步进电机的控制。实现对步进电机的正反转速度控制并且显示数据。整个系统采用模块化设计,结构简单、可靠,通过按键控制,操作方便,节省成本。 相似文献
8.
9.
10.
根据Nios Ⅱ处理器的Avalon总线规范,设计了一款面向步进电机的控制器IP核。该定制IP核采用软、硬件协同设计的方法,功能符合Avalon总线的读写传输时序,具有完备的步进电机驱动能力。仿真结果表明,该IP核具有很好的可重用性,利于开源共享提高开发效率 相似文献
11.
研究的是基于FPGA的电机测速系统设计。该设计以有源晶振来产生时基信号,利用欧姆龙光电编码器E6B2-CWZ6C360P/R将转速信号转变为频率信号,采用数码管动态显示来显示测量所得的数值。FPGA模块的编写是基于Altera公司的Quartus II软件进行编写的,采用的芯片型号为EP2C5T144C8N。FPGA模块是利用VHDL语言进行编写,利用Quartus II软件自带的仿真软件进行仿真,通过观察仿真波形来验证模块是否正确。本设计可以实现小数值的方波频率测量和电机转速测量。 相似文献
12.
为提高电机转速测量仪的测量精度,解决传统测量仪校准方法中校准效果不明显的问题,提出基于FPGA的电机转速测量仪实时校准方法.利用电机转速的监测电路,实时收集电机转速信号,并以此作为电机转速的实际值.根据测量仪的测量原理,得出电机转速的测量值.分析测量仪的测量误差,并结合实际值与测量值之间的差值确定测量仪的实时校准值.在... 相似文献
13.
在工程实践中,有许多生产机械要求在一定的范围内进行速度的平滑调节,并且要求有良好的静,动态性能。采用DSP控制器控制后,整个调速系统实现全数字化,结构简单,可靠性高,操作维护方便,电机稳态运行时转速精度可达到较高水平。直流电机具有调速平滑,调速范围广等优良的调速特性。又由于直流调速系统是自动化专业教学的重点,本设计为学生们提供了一个良好的实验平台,同学们可以通过此平台进行直流电机调速的实验,可以通过改变PI参数理解PID算法对直流电机启动和调速性能的影响。 相似文献
14.
基于FPGA的SDRAM控制器设计 总被引:7,自引:0,他引:7
SDRAM是一种大容量、高速度的动态存储器,在电子设计领域应用很广泛。本文介绍了在雷达光栅显示系统中,应用SDRAM作为视频存储器时,采用FPGA实现控制电路的过程. 相似文献
15.
16.
针对小卫星姿态控制问题,提出了一种基于FPGA实现的PID姿态控制器.然后在MATLAB/Simulink环境下模拟卫星动力学计算机,通过MATLAB的Serial串口对象与FPGA开发板交换信息.基于FPGA的PID控制器对整个系统进行控制,最后的仿真结果证明了该方案的可行性和准确性. 相似文献
17.
18.
19.
20.
为了提高开发的效率,缩短其开发的时间,设计师逐渐转向可编程逻辑器件的开发。文章介绍了应用FPGA采用自顶向下的方法来设计数字钟的方案。设计时,首先用VHDL语言编写各个功能模块,分别在QuartusⅡ开发环境下编译、仿真,然后再用顶层文件将各功能模块连接起来,最后在实验箱上进行测试,证实该设计方法切实可行。 相似文献